متن کاملA Differential Spectroscopic Analysis of 16 Cygni A and B
We utilize high-resolution, high signal-to-noise spectra to perform a differential analysis of Fe abundances in the common proper-motion pair 16 Cyg A and B. We confirm that both stars are slightly metal-rich compared to the Sun, and we show for the first time that the primary is enhanced in Fe relative to the secondary by a significant amount. متن کاملVelocity curve analysis of spectroscopic binary stars EQ Tau, V376 And, V776 Cas, V2377 Oph and V380 Cygni by nonlinear regression
Using measured radial velocity data of five double-lined spectroscopic binary systems EQ Tau, V376 And, V776 Cas, V2377 Oph and V380 Cygni, we find corresponding orbital and spectroscopic elements via the method introduced by Karami & Teimoorinia and Karami & Mohebi. Our numerical results are in good agreement with those obtained by others using more traditional methods.
